Struktur EMRSETDIBITSTODEVICE (wingdi.h)

Struktur EMRSETDIBITSTODEVICE berisi anggota untuk rekaman metafile yang disempurnakan SetDIBitsToDevice .

Sintaks

typedef struct tagEMRSETDIBITSTODEVICE {
  EMR   emr;
  RECTL rclBounds;
  LONG  xDest;
  LONG  yDest;
  LONG  xSrc;
  LONG  ySrc;
  LONG  cxSrc;
  LONG  cySrc;
  DWORD offBmiSrc;
  DWORD cbBmiSrc;
  DWORD offBitsSrc;
  DWORD cbBitsSrc;
  DWORD iUsageSrc;
  DWORD iStartScan;
  DWORD cScans;
} EMRSETDIBITSTODEVICE, *PEMRSETDIBITSTODEVICE;

Anggota

emr

Struktur dasar untuk semua jenis rekaman.

rclBounds

Persegi panjang pembatas, di unit perangkat.

xDest

Koordinat x logis sudut kiri atas persegi panjang tujuan.

yDest

Koordinat y logis sudut kiri atas persegi panjang tujuan.

xSrc

Koordinat x logis dari sudut kiri bawah bitmap independen perangkat sumber (DIB).

ySrc

Koordinat y logis dari sudut kiri bawah diB sumber.

cxSrc

Lebar persegi panjang sumber, dalam unit logis.

cySrc

Tinggi persegi panjang sumber, dalam unit logis.

offBmiSrc

Offset ke struktur BITMAPINFO sumber.

cbBmiSrc

Ukuran struktur BITMAPINFO sumber.

offBitsSrc

Offset ke bitmap sumber.

cbBitsSrc

Ukuran bitmap sumber.

iUsageSrc

Nilai anggota bmiColors dari struktur BITMAPINFO . Anggota iUsageSrc dapat berupa nilai DIB_PAL_COLORS atau DIB_RGB_COLORS.

iStartScan

Baris pemindaian pertama dalam array.

cScans

Jumlah baris pemindaian.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 2000 Professional [hanya aplikasi desktop]
Server minimum yang didukung Windows 2000 Server [hanya aplikasi desktop]
Header wingdi.h (sertakan Windows.h)

Lihat juga

BITMAPINFO

Struktur Metafile

Gambaran Umum Metafiles

SetDIBitsToDevice